024 of 108 Names of Lord Shiva : Kapaalee - Who has a Skull

Published: Aug. 23, 2020, 5:01 p.m.

b'One who has Kapaala or a Skull. It is the 10 th rudra of ekadasha rudra.

Padmapurana Shrishti khanda 17 says:\\u2028Once Lord Shiva went to a yagna of Brahmaji wearing skulls. He was not allowed entry. The Lord had to show his power and glory. Then they sought forgiveness from the Lord and He was given a seat to the North of Brahmaji.

At another instance, He had once cut the head of Brahmaji with his nail for telling lies about having found the top of the Infinite coloumn of light. One whose hands were glued to Brahma\\u2019s head which was cut by Him by his nails is Kapaalee. He begged for alms from Annapoorna, his own wife. He went to Kashi and then purified himself with Ganga Snan. This was the prayaschitta he did to set an example for others.

Lord Shiva holds the skull of Brahma the creator. This shows that the Lord is above all creators. This also shows the Eternity of the Lord. Even Brahma the creator has a fixed life time but Lord Shiva is Eternal.

Skull is also the symbol of human pride. He takes it away from us and makes us humble. He destroyed the Daksha Yagna also in this
form of Kapaalee.
